Extension of Services. In the event of an extension of a Service pursuant to Article VIII, the Recipient of such Service shall be obligated to pay the Applicable Service Fee for such Service calculated as set forth on the applicable Service Schedule as the Applicable Service Fee payable during any period of extension. The Parties agree and acknowledge that fees payable for Services that are extended may be higher than during the initial term of such Service. For the avoidance of doubt, nothing herein shall constitute an obligation of any Party to extend the period for which it will provide any Service if such extension is not contemplated by the applicable Service Schedule.
